What does it mean when book characters dress to impress? When a book character dresses to impress, they are making an effort to look their best. They may be trying to attract someone's attention, make a good impression, or simply feel more confident. Whatever the reason, dressing to impress can be an important part of a character's development.

For example, in the novel "The Great Gatsby," Jay Gatsby is known for his impeccable style. He always dresses to the nines, even when he's just going to a party. This shows that Gatsby is a man who cares about his appearance and wants to make a good impression. It also suggests that Gatsby is trying to hide his true identity and create a new persona for himself.

Dressing to impress can also be a sign of respect. When a character dresses up for a special occasion, they are showing that they care about the event and the people they are attending it with. For example, in the novel "To Kill a Mockingbird," Scout Finch dresses up for her first day of school. This shows that she is taking her education seriously and wants to make a good impression on her teacher and classmates.

Of course, dressing to impress can also be a way to show off. When a character wears expensive clothes or accessories, they are trying to draw attention to themselves and make others envious. For example, in the novel "The Hunger Games," Katniss Everdeen wears a beautiful dress to the Capitol. This shows that she is not afraid to stand out and that she is confident in her own abilities.

Ultimately, the meaning of "book characters dress to impress" depends on the context of the story. However, it is always an important part of a character's development and can reveal a lot about their personality and motivations.
